How to Install Jamroom via Softaculous in cPanel

Softaculous makes it easy to install web applications. Please follow the steps below to install Jamroom.

  1. Log in to your cPanel account.
  2. In the Software section, click on Softaculous Apps Installer.
  3. cPanel will redirect you to the Softaculous interface.
  4. On the left side, locate the Portal/CMS category. Click on it, then click on the Jamroom link that appears.
  5. Click on Install.
  6. Fill in the necessary fields under the Software Setup section:
    • Choose Installation URL: Select the appropriate protocol/domain. In the "In Directory" field, if you want to install this in a directory (e.g., example.com/directory), enter the directory name. Otherwise, leave it blank to install in your main domain (e.g., example.com).
  7. Under the Admin Account section, enter the following information:
    • Admin Username: Your new Jamroom username (for security reasons, do not use "administrator" or "admin").
    • Admin Password: Use a strong password.
    • Admin Email: Your email address. This is helpful for admin account password resets and notifications.

    Note: Copy the admin username and password to Notepad. You will need these to access the admin area of your Jamroom website later.

  8. Advanced Options: Leave this section as is unless you want to change the database name or enable automated backups. Please note that creating frequent backups may consume a lot of disk space.
  9. Finally, scroll down to the end of the page and click on Install.
